Output 17aa2086e3611b868bfeb8a323c9117b23e296a6c3128cab9b08bbb5eda65ca7:0

value
25364337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 213edf585bafddf14b086f055f38c7bcb6a9095e OP_EQUAL
address
MAvwrDPeX77tprWQcbh5bDfx3Qc7xTmDVz
transaction
17aa2086e3611b868bfeb8a323c9117b23e296a6c3128cab9b08bbb5eda65ca7
spent
true